Output 6bd36a316015b3a3908fcb2d908dd99e030af46ca5997f8e56b4943cb0160e17:46

value
85190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ea0a5014907de6751da4174e9a9446b765e40c9 OP_EQUAL
address
3PSmByhpFUHj5MjSEJBpqyarQt9xjtQnFY
transaction
6bd36a316015b3a3908fcb2d908dd99e030af46ca5997f8e56b4943cb0160e17
confirmations
234288
spent
true